Understanding Anesthesia During Labor
Anesthesia during labor plays a pivotal role in managing the intense pain associated with childbirth. It’s not a one-size-fits-all approach but rather a spectrum of methods designed to ease discomfort while maintaining safety for both mother and infant. Pain during labor can vary greatly, from mild contractions to overwhelming sensations, and anesthesia provides an option for mothers seeking relief.
The primary goal is to reduce pain without compromising the ability to push or interfere with the natural progression of labor. Anesthesia techniques range from local numbing agents to regional blocks and even general anesthesia in rare cases. Each method has its own indications, benefits, risks, and timing considerations.
Types of Anesthesia Used in Labor
There are several anesthesia options available during labor, each suited for different stages or preferences:
- Epidural Anesthesia: The most common form, involving injection into the epidural space around the spinal cord, blocking pain from the waist down.
- Spinal Anesthesia: A single injection into the spinal fluid offering rapid and dense numbness, often used for cesarean sections.
- Combined Spinal-Epidural (CSE): Combines benefits of both techniques by providing quick relief with longer-lasting effects.
- Local Anesthesia: Used for numbing specific areas such as an episiotomy site or suturing tears after delivery.
- General Anesthesia: Rarely used in labor but may be necessary in emergencies requiring immediate cesarean delivery.
Each technique varies in onset time, duration, intensity of numbness, and side effect profile. Selecting the right method depends on individual circumstances including labor progression, maternal health, fetal status, and personal preferences.
The Epidural: The Gold Standard of Labor Pain Relief
Epidural anesthesia stands out as the most widely used method for pain control during labor. It involves placing a catheter into the epidural space in the lower back through which medication is administered continuously or intermittently.
The medications used typically combine a local anesthetic with a small dose of opioid. This combination blocks nerve signals that transmit pain while minimizing motor block—allowing mothers to retain some movement and control during pushing.
How Epidurals Work
Once placed correctly by an anesthesiologist or nurse anesthetist, the epidural catheter delivers medication close to nerve roots exiting the spinal cord. This interrupts pain signals before they reach the brain.
Pain relief usually begins within 10-20 minutes after administration. The dosage can be adjusted throughout labor depending on pain levels or side effects such as low blood pressure or itching.
Epidural Benefits and Risks
Epidurals provide profound pain relief without putting mother or baby at significant risk when properly managed:
- Benefits: Effective pain control; allows rest; reduces stress hormone release; customizable dosing; awake mother able to participate actively.
- Risks: Possible drop in blood pressure; headache from accidental dural puncture; temporary difficulty urinating; rare nerve injury; potential for longer second stage of labor.
Despite some drawbacks, epidurals have revolutionized childbirth comfort worldwide. Careful monitoring minimizes complications and ensures maternal-fetal well-being throughout use.
Other Regional Techniques: Spinal and Combined Spinal-Epidural
While epidurals dominate labor analgesia choices, spinal anesthesia offers an alternative primarily reserved for cesarean deliveries due to its rapid onset and profound block.
The combined spinal-epidural (CSE) technique merges quick spinal anesthesia onset with prolonged epidural infusion benefits. This approach provides immediate relief along with flexibility for extended labor analgesia.
Spinal Anesthesia Characteristics
Spinal anesthesia involves injecting medication directly into cerebrospinal fluid surrounding nerves in the lower spine. It produces rapid numbness within minutes but tends to have a shorter duration than epidurals.
It’s highly effective for scheduled cesarean sections where quick surgical anesthesia is needed without general anesthesia risks.
The Combined Spinal-Epidural Advantage
CSE allows mothers to experience fast initial pain relief via spinal injection followed by sustained epidural dosing throughout labor progression. This technique is popular when early analgesia is desired without committing immediately to a full epidural catheter placement.
It also permits easier dosage adjustments compared to pure spinal anesthesia alone.
Anesthesia During Labor: Safety Considerations
Safety remains paramount when administering any form of anesthesia during labor. Both maternal and fetal well-being must be closely monitored before, during, and after anesthetic administration.
Maternal Monitoring
Vital signs such as blood pressure, heart rate, oxygen saturation, and respiratory status are continuously observed. Epidurals can cause hypotension (low blood pressure), so intravenous fluids are often given beforehand as preventive measures.
Urinary retention is common due to reduced sensation; thus catheterization may be necessary temporarily until normal bladder function returns post-delivery.
Fetal Monitoring
Continuous fetal heart rate monitoring ensures that oxygen delivery remains adequate despite maternal hemodynamic changes caused by anesthesia drugs. Any signs of distress prompt immediate evaluation by obstetric teams.
Anesthetic Drug Safety Profiles
Medications used in labor analgesia have been extensively studied for teratogenicity (birth defects) or neonatal respiratory depression risks. Modern agents like bupivacaine combined with fentanyl provide effective analgesia at doses low enough to minimize fetal exposure.
In addition, local anesthetics do not cross into breast milk significantly post-delivery—meaning breastfeeding remains safe shortly after birth even if regional anesthesia was administered earlier.
The Impact of Anesthesia During Labor on Delivery Outcomes
There has been ongoing debate about how anesthesia influences labor duration and delivery modes like vaginal birth versus cesarean section rates.
Labor Duration Effects
Epidurals may slightly prolong the second stage (pushing phase) because numbness reduces maternal urge or strength needed for pushing effectively. However, this extension rarely leads to adverse outcomes when managed properly by healthcare providers guiding pushing techniques carefully.
Cesarean Section Rates
Earlier studies suggested higher cesarean rates with epidurals but more recent research shows no significant increase when other factors are controlled. Epidurals allow mothers who might otherwise avoid surgery due to fear of pain better tolerance through vaginal delivery attempts—potentially lowering emergency cesareans overall.
Anesthesia During Labor Table: Comparison of Common Techniques
| Anesthetic Technique | Onset Time | Main Uses & Notes |
|---|---|---|
| Epidural Anesthesia | 10–20 minutes | Pain relief throughout labor; adjustable dosing; allows movement; most common choice. |
| Spinal Anesthesia | 1–5 minutes | Cesarean section anesthesia; fast onset but shorter duration; denser block than epidural. |
| Combined Spinal-Epidural (CSE) | 1–5 minutes (spinal part) | Merges quick relief with long-term management; useful if early analgesia desired. |
| Local Anesthesia | Immediate (seconds) | Numbs small areas like perineum for stitches or episiotomy repair. |
| General Anesthesia | Immediate (seconds) | Sedates mother fully; reserved for emergencies or contraindications to regional blocks. |
Pain Management Choices Beyond Anesthesia During Labor
Not every mother opts for pharmacological intervention during childbirth. Non-medical methods also play vital roles in coping strategies:
- Mental techniques: Breathing exercises, meditation, hypnobirthing help control perception of pain.
- TENS units: Electrical nerve stimulation applied externally can reduce mild discomfort.
- Morphine or opioids: Systemic medications injected intramuscularly or intravenously offer partial relief but come with sedation risks.
- Nitrous oxide: Inhaled gas providing mild analgesia with rapid clearance from body.
- Water immersion: Soaking in warm water relaxes muscles and eases contractions’ intensity.
Choosing between these options depends on personal preference, medical history, hospital policies, and anticipated labor course. Discussing plans ahead with healthcare providers ensures alignment on expectations and safety measures.
The Role of Healthcare Providers in Administering Anesthesia During Labor
Anesthesiologists or certified nurse anesthetists are specialized professionals trained extensively in delivering safe regional blocks tailored specifically for obstetric patients.
They perform thorough pre-procedure assessments including reviewing allergies, coagulation status (to avoid bleeding complications), infection signs near injection sites, and spine anatomy considerations like scoliosis or prior surgeries affecting needle placement feasibility.
During administration:
- Aseptic technique prevents infections at needle insertion points.
- The patient’s position is optimized—usually sitting up or lying on her side—to ease access to lumbar vertebrae spaces.
- A test dose confirms correct placement before full medication delivery begins.
After placement:
- Mothers receive continuous monitoring while adjusting doses based on feedback about sensation changes or side effects.
This team effort includes nurses who assist with positioning and monitoring vital signs plus obstetricians coordinating timing relative to cervical dilation progress ensuring optimal outcomes without delays or complications related to analgesia use.
The Emotional Dimension: How Anesthesia Influences Birth Experience
Pain management affects more than just physical sensations—it shapes emotional memories tied to childbirth profoundly. For many women suffering intense contractions unrelieved by other means, anesthesia can transform fear into empowerment by restoring control over their bodies during one of life’s most challenging moments.
Conversely, some mothers worry about losing sensation altogether or feeling disconnected from their birthing process due to numbing effects—highlighting why clear communication about what each method entails beforehand matters deeply.
Hospitals increasingly encourage shared decision-making models where patients receive detailed counseling about pros/cons so they feel confident choosing their preferred approach rather than being surprised mid-labor under duress conditions.
